What are the key differences between Tim Sykes' penny stock rules and cryptocurrency trading rules?

- Omar BablghoomJan 11, 2023 · 3 years agoTim Sykes' penny stock rules focus on low-priced stocks traded on traditional stock exchanges, while cryptocurrency trading rules apply to digital currencies traded on cryptocurrency exchanges. Penny stock rules often emphasize finding undervalued stocks with potential for quick gains, while cryptocurrency trading rules may involve analyzing market trends and technological developments. Additionally, penny stock rules may involve more traditional trading strategies, such as technical analysis and fundamental analysis, while cryptocurrency trading rules may incorporate more innovative strategies like algorithmic trading and sentiment analysis.

- MudassirJun 01, 2024 · 2 years agoWhen comparing Tim Sykes' penny stock rules to cryptocurrency trading rules, it's important to note that the two markets operate in different environments. Penny stocks are subject to regulations and oversight by traditional stock exchanges and regulatory bodies, while cryptocurrencies operate in a decentralized and often unregulated market. This difference in regulation can impact trading strategies and risk management. Additionally, the volatility and liquidity of cryptocurrencies can differ significantly from penny stocks, requiring traders to adapt their strategies accordingly.
